LASWA Confirms Fire On Ferry As All Passengers Safely Evacuated

The Lagos State Waterways Authority (LASWA) has confirmed a fire outbreak on the Igbega Eko ferry at the Ipakodo Ferry Terminal in Ikorodu. The incident occurred at approximately 6:45 a.m. while the vessel was en route to Victoria Island.
In a statement on Thursday, LASWA General Manager Oluwadamilola Emmanuel said emergency teams swiftly responded to the distress call, working alongside LAGFERRY, boat operators, and other first responders to contain the situation.
“We are pleased to report that all passengers and crew on board were evacuated safely, though four passengers suffered minor injuries and are currently receiving medical attention,” Emmanuel stated.
LASWA has launched a thorough investigation, in collaboration with LAGFERRY and other stakeholders, to determine the cause of the fire. The agency reaffirmed its commitment to strengthening fire prevention measures across Lagos waterways.
“Safety is our utmost priority, and we are committed to implementing any necessary recommendations to enhance fire prevention measures throughout the Lagos waterways,” Emmanuel added.
Despite the incident, LASWA assured the public that ferry operations remain unaffected, urging passengers to stay calm and adhere to safety protocols while commuting on the waterways.
